    It is highly dependent upon condition and if there is any special variety. At minimum, it's worth its silver melt value of $6.34. But, if it is nicely uncirculated for a good variety...it could be worth more.

    The only variety I know of...if it's a Philly coin is a Type B reverse.

    Check the reverse of the coin, below the eagle, and see if there is a letter.
    I believe it can only have a blank spot, or a 'D' in 57.
    If it is blank, it was minted (made) in Philidelphia, if it has a 'D', it was minted in Denver.

    If the coin has any marks or wear, it is pretty much worth melt.
    If it is 'gem', it could be as high as 15-20 bux.
    If it is in a graded slab, from a reputable grading company, it could bring more, depending on exact grade attributed to it on the slab label.
